Quick single-phase transformer planning calculator for current and kVA. Use this for planning and training. Verify final conductor, OCPD, and installation decisions against the current NEC and actual equipment nameplate data.
| Electrical foundation | Transformer apparent power relationship: kVA = volts × amps ÷ 1000 for single phase, and kVA = √3 × volts × amps ÷ 1000 for three phase. |
